Course Description
The trading, sales, and marketing of crude oil and refined petroleum products form the backbone of global energy commerce. As one of the most strategically important commodities, crude oil is traded through complex supply chains involving upstream producers, national oil companies, international oil companies, trading houses, refiners, marketers, and end-users. The pricing is influenced by multiple market benchmarks (Brent, WTI, Dubai), geopolitical events, OPEC+ policies, shipping logistics, and derivatives trading.
With increasing market volatility, decarbonization pressures, regulatory requirements, and digital transformation in trading, professionals involved in petroleum sales and marketing must possess deep technical knowledge of market structures, trading instruments, logistics, contractual frameworks, risk management, and price mechanisms.
